The roofing market in Marriottsville, MD, is highly specialized due to the local climate, which features hot, humid summers and cold winters with potential for heavy snow, ice, and strong storms from nor'easters. This creates significant demand for durable, weather-resistant roofing systems and reliable storm damage restoration services. Contractors must be well-versed in Howard County building codes and the specific challenges of the area, including wind-driven rain and hail. The market is competitive with a focus on quality materials, strong warranties, and expertise in navigating insurance claims for weather-related damage.

For a standard 2,000-2,500 sq. ft. home in the Marriottsville area, a full asphalt shingle roof replacement typically ranges from $12,000 to $25,000. The final cost depends on roof complexity, material quality (e.g., architectural vs. 3-tab shingles), and the extent of decking repair needed. Maryland's higher labor costs and material prices compared to national averages, along with local disposal fees, influence this range.
The ideal windows are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October) to avoid summer's extreme heat/humidity and winter's freezing temperatures, which can affect materials like sealants. Most standard replacements take 2-4 days, but this can extend with unpredictable spring/fall rain showers common in Howard County. Scheduling well in advance for these peak seasons is crucial.
Yes, Howard County requires a building permit for a full roof replacement, which includes a required third-party inspection of the roof deck before new underlayment and shingles are installed. The county also enforces specific wind uplift resistance standards (often requiring ASTM D3161 Class F or D7158 Class H shingles) due to our region's susceptibility to strong thunderstorms and occasional tropical storm remnants.
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have a strong physical presence in Howard County. Verify they hold a Maryland Home Improvement Commission (MHIC) license and check for local references. Given the area's mix of older homes and newer developments, choose a provider with experience handling both the architectural styles and the specific weather challenges of Central Maryland.
